commercial facility management refers to the process of managing the physical assets and infrastructure of a commercial property. This includes everything from managing building maintenance and repairs to ensuring compliance with safety regulations and overseeing security protocols. In essence, commercial facility management is responsible for creating and maintaining a safe, comfortable, and efficient work environment for employees and customers.
One of the primary goals of commercial facility management is to maximize efficiency and productivity within a commercial setting. By ensuring that the physical assets and infrastructure of a commercial property are properly maintained and running smoothly, facility managers can help businesses operate more effectively. For example, regular maintenance and repairs can help prevent costly breakdowns and downtime, allowing employees to focus on their work without interruptions.
In addition to maintenance and repairs, commercial facility management also plays a crucial role in ensuring the safety and security of a commercial property. Facility managers are responsible for implementing and enforcing safety protocols and regulations to protect employees, customers, and visitors. This can include everything from conducting regular safety inspections to installing security systems and monitoring CCTV cameras. By prioritizing safety and security, facility managers help create a secure and welcoming environment for everyone in the commercial facility.
Another key aspect of commercial facility management is cost management. Facility managers are responsible for creating and managing budgets for maintenance, repairs, and other expenses related to the upkeep of the commercial property. By monitoring expenses and identifying cost-saving opportunities, facility managers can help businesses operate more efficiently and effectively. This not only helps save money in the long run but also ensures that resources are allocated strategically to maximize productivity.
Furthermore, commercial facility management plays a crucial role in enhancing the overall experience for employees, customers, and visitors. By maintaining a clean, well-maintained, and organized commercial property, facility managers can create a positive and welcoming atmosphere that promotes productivity and satisfaction. From ensuring that HVAC systems are functioning properly to keeping common areas clean and clutter-free, facility managers contribute to creating a comfortable and productive work environment.
